Loretta's Cafe is a charming eatery nestled in the heart of Shelton, CT, offering a cozy atmosphere and a menu of classic American dishes.
With a focus on quality ingredients and friendly service, Loretta's Cafe provides a casual dining experience for locals and visitors alike to enjoy.
Generated from their business information